Take Vince's advice. Many routers just cannot do this. I must admit I am baffled by the very long time - it should be fast or not at all.
In addition, you are mixing IPv4 and IPv6 in your tests, but the ddns.net service returns IPv4 only. Your weewx system is accessible from the outside world using IPv4, but not if I use either IPv6 address you showed, so I suspect you need changed firewall rules for that. If you had a full IPv6 pathway then it does not need NAT and should work from anywhere.
